Must win M'rashtra was the BJP's sole objective

I am really disappointed with the Maharashtra state elections with the BJP-led coalition getting a thumping majority!  However, I think that unless elections are moved to ballot paper,  I and many others cannot respect these elections results. It is very clear how currently, the BJP controlled ECI has different set of rules for BJP, allies vs. others. Also, why is it that all other major/highly rated democracies use ballot paper and India is the only major democracy which uses EVMs, where many experts confirm they could be manipulated? Maharashtra is a very high stakes state (BJP politicians & crony capitalists) and there is so much to lose for them; that the BJP can prioritize EVM manipulation here. It’s well known how mega “money making” projects in Maharashtra are specially handed over to BJP’s favourite crony capitalists. I think it’s a Herculean and too risky effort to manipulate EVMs at a 100% rate, and the ruling BJP party has to pick and choose, where absolutely necessary and stakes are absolutely the highest.  Hence “the must win Maharashtra at all costs and afford to lose Jharkhand”  was in my view the BJP objective.
